The work of the renzo piano building workshop is characterized by its sensitivity to genius loci and local tradition as well as by its mix of traditional materials and techniques with those from the leading edge of technology. His notable buildings include the centre georges pompidou in paris with richard rogers, 1977, the shard in london 2012, and the whitney museum of american art in new york city 2015 and stavros niarchos foundation cultural center in athens 2016.
